Классы :: Компоненты и Классы :: База знаний Delphi :: "Внутренние поля класса и их инициализация в Delphi и Pascal" ### Ответ на русском языке:
Обсуждение на форуме касается инициализации внутренних полей классов и использования конструкторов в языках программирования Delphi и Pascal для обеспечения корректного состояния объектов и их модульности. :: Все 270 классов Delphi
Все 270 классов Delphi. :: Вывести информацию о классах
"Вывести информацию о классах" - это программный код на языке Pascal, который выводит информацию о классах в формате RTTI (Run-Time Type Information). Код содержит список из более 100 классов Delphi, которые добавляются в список listBox1. :: Глобальный объект Clipboard Объект Clipboard в Delphi позволяет обмениваться информацией между приложениями, имеет три свойства - AsText для текстового обмена, FormatCount для получения общего числа форматов в буфере и Formats для доступа к значениям идентификаторов формата. :: Глобальный объект Screen Объект Screen - глобальный объект в Delphi, инкапсулирующий свойства дисплея, позволяет управлять видом курсора, получать параметры монитора и список установленных шрифтов. :: Иерархия классов
Иерархия классов в Delphi. :: Изменить заголовки компонент различных классов
В статье описывается изменение заголовков компонентов различных классов в программе на языке Delphi, используя пример с формой и ее элементами. :: Информация о TClass
Описание класса TClass и его использования для определения типа объекта, а также примеры создания дополнительных типов и наследования классов. :: Информация о классах
Код программы на языке Pascal, представляющий собой интерфейс и реализацию формы с использованием компонентов Delphi. :: Использование Clear, Remove и Delete в TFPGMAP TFPGMAP — это универсальный контейнер в FGL, реализующий интерфейс IMap, позволяющий хранить пары ключ-значение, а также правильное использование методов Clear, Remove и Delete для удаления элементов и управления памятью. :: Использование конструкции WITH в коде на Delphi: почему стоит избегать её Конструкция ``WITH`` в Delphi упрощает доступ к свойствам и методам объекта, но может вызвать неоднозначность и проблемы с областью видимости. :: Как динамически прочитать информацию о классе
Статья описывает способ динамически прочитать информацию о классе в Delphi с помощью процедуры GetClass и регистрации классов с помощью функции RegisterClasses. :: Как написать собственный класс
В статье рассказывается о том, как написать собственный класс в Delphi, с помощью примера класса TStatistic, который вычисляет сумму квадратов введенных чисел. :: Класс TComponent Класс TComponent является предком всех компонентов VCL и реализует основные механизмы, обеспечивающие функционирование любого компонента. :: Класс TObject Класс TObject является родоначальником всей иерархии использующихся в Delphi классов VCL, реализует функции, обязательные для любого объекта, создаваемого в среде разработки. :: Класс TPersistent Класс TPersistent в Delphi - это абстрактный класс, который обеспечивает возможность присвоения (копирования) значений свойств между объектами различного класса. :: Класс TWinControl и TControl Класс TWinControl в Delphi обеспечивает создание и использование оконных элементов управления, обладающих системным дескриптором окна hwnd. :: Класс для манипулирования списком вещественных чисел
Класс TxFloatList - это обобщение списков вещественных чисел для использования в программировании на языке Delphi, позволяющее оперировать динамическим списком вещественных чисел (тип Double) двойной точности. :: Класс для манипулирования списком целых чисел
Класс для манипулирования списком целых чисел, позволяющий оперировать динамическим списком целых чисел (тип LONGINT), обеспечивает создание, удаление, вставку и доступ к элементам списка, а также сортировку списка. :: Класс-оболочка для объекта синхронизации WaitableTimer
Класс-оболочка для объекта синхронизации WaitableTimer представляет собой оболочку для объекта синхронизации, существующего в операционных системах на базе ядра WinNT. :: Найти все классы, зарегистрированные классом формы
Найдите все классы, зарегистрированные классом формы, используя функцию GetFieldClasstable и рекурсивно обойдите родительские классы. :: Найти классы, зарегистрированные классом формы
В статье описывается способ нахождения классов, зарегистрированных в классе формы Delphi, с помощью функции GetFieldClassTable и цикла поиска родительских классов. :: Определение наследника класса по имени - аналог IS
Функция HSClassBasedOn позволяет определить наследника класса по имени, не требуя привязки к RTTI определяемого класса. :: Поиск класса
В статье рассматривается вопрос о том, как можно найти класс с именем Tlog в приложении, и предлагаются несколько решений для реализации поиска класса и доступа к его методам и свойствам. :: Показать нужную форму по имени класса
Показать нужную форму по имени класса можно с помощью процедуры ShowOneOfMyForm, которая инициализирует форму при помощи FindClass и последующего создания объекта. :: Получение информации о классе и об окне
Получение информации о классе и окне. :: Получение ссылки на класс из объекта
Получение ссылки на класс из объекта - это процесс, который позволяет дублировать экземпляры классов в Delphi, используя метод ClassType или RegisterClass для создания ссылки на класс. :: Получение ссылки на класс из объекта 2
Автор статьи Pat Ritchey описывает способ получения ссылки на класс из объекта, используя метод TObject.ClassType и создания нового объекта с помощью вызова Create. :: Получить информацию о классе
В статье описывается механизм работы с классами в Delphi, включая получение информации о классе, его наследии и свойствах. :: Работа с TApplication Данное описание статьи по работе с классом TApplication на русском языке: "Эта статья описывает основные свойства и методы класса TApplication, который является фундаментальным классом в Delphi для создания Windows-приложений." :: Регистрация классов
Регистрация классов в Delphi: пример регистрации и использования классового массива. :: Создание или управление формами по названию класса
Создание или управление формами в Delphi можно реализовать с помощью классов и интерфейсов, позволяя создавать формы по их наименованиям классов. :: Создание массива деревьев В статье рассматривается возможность создания автоконструктора для объектов в Object Pascal (Delphi), который бы автоматически вызывался при создании объекта без явного вызова. Для реализации автоконструктора предложено использовать свойства объекта или и :: Создание потомка от класса зарегистрированного в Delphi
Создание потомка класса TPanel в Delphi для определения событий при наведении и отведении мыши над панелью. :: Создать компонент любого класса
В статье описывается создание компонента любого класса в Delphi, используя интерфейс и функции языка программирования. :: Список объектов класса TDate
"Объект класса TDate - это класс, который представляет собой дату с возможностью изменения месяца, дня и года. Он имеет свойство Text, которое возвращает строку в формате 'Месяц День, Год'. Класс TDateListI - это список об :: Удаление объектов, освобождение памяти
В статье рассматриваются вопросы удаления объектов и освобождения памяти в программировании на языке Pascal, с использованием примеров на основе Delphi.
Узнайте обо всех аспектах работы с классами в Delphi - получение информации о классе и его наследовании, управление объектами и компонентами, использование классовых массивов и регистрация классов. Найдите нужный вам класс среди 270 доступных в Delphi и изучите примеры создания собственных классов. Узнайте, как управлять объектами синхронизации и работать с классами TObject, TComponent, TWinControl, TPanel, Screen и Clipboard. Прочитайте статьи эксперта Pat Ritchey о получении ссылки на класс из объекта и создании новых объектов.
Получайте свежие новости и обновления по Object Pascal, Delphi и Lazarus прямо в свой смартфон. Подпишитесь на наш Telegram-канал delphi_kansoftware и будьте в курсе последних тенденций в разработке под Linux, Windows, Android и iOS :: Главная ::
|